Partner Mark Ginsberg recently moderated a panel titled “Increasing Housing Production: City of Yes,” at New York State Association for Affordable Housing (NYSAFAH)’s Annual New York State Affordable Housing Conference. The panelists Robert Holbrook, Edith Hsu-Chen, Josh Rinesmith, and Howard Slatkin, discussed the City of Yes for Housing Opportunity, a zoning reform proposal that would help address the housing crisis by making it possible to build a little more housing…

We’re honored to announce our selection for NYSERDA’s Empire Building Challenge

We're honored to announce our selection for NYSERDA's #EmpireBuildingChallenge cohort 3 with MaGrann Associates & Ascendant Neighborhood Development. Empire Building Challenge (EBC) is a partnership between NYSERDA and leading commercial real estate owners. Through this program, NYSERDA will invest $50 million to elevate new design approaches for low-carbon retrofits in New York’s high-rise buildings. C+GA attended the Climate Ready Buildings Training

C+GA’s Karla Gutierrez RA, CPHC®, Seo Choi, and Shreejit Modak attended the Climate Ready Buildings Training by Building Energy Exchange. This training educates affordable housing project teams on how to design and construct high performance buildings that are resilient to the increasing pressure of climate change and align with NY’s climate goals.
